The Detroit Grand Prix was a race on the Formula One calendar.
The race gained a reputation for being incredibly demanding and gruelling, with the very bumpy track often breaking up badly under the consistently hot and very humid weather; it was perhaps the single hardest race on car and driver in Formula One during the 1980s.
Formula One racing returned to the streets of Detroit in 2010 at the (unrelated) Detroit Belle Isle Raceway, albeit under the designation of the United States Grand Prix.
